ICAN is excited to announce Jamie Serrano as our newest chapter leader! She has completed training and will be leading ICAN of South Suburban Chicago!

Tell us about the birth climate in your area.

“I believe that all women can have a better birth with good education about their options and a supportive provider who respects them.”
We are located in the southwest suburbs of Chicago. We serve the Chicago southside, as well as the southern and southwestern suburbs. We have a lot of very wonderful doulas, but I wish we had the option for VBAC in birth centers.

Why get involved in ICAN?
I found ICAN through a Google search when I was looking for support groups after my c-section. I loved the support and sense of community I felt when I attended my first meeting. I am looking forward to supporting other women in their c-section recovery. I wish more people knew that ICAN existed!

Please share a little about yourself!
I am an attorney, wife, and mother. I enjoy spending time with my family, being outdoors, and cooking. My friends would say that I’m kind and caring and enjoy helping others. My first daughter was a c-section in 2012 at 36w4d due to breech presentation and maternal pre-eclampsia and HELLP syndrome. My second daughter was a hospital VBAC at 40w1d with a healthy mama. I am expecting my third daughter and planning another hospital VBAC.
